Transaction 54506386292b7eef52b97380e268c509f225c73c3627bb4578ef14cc88fafc30
1 Input
1 Output
-
54506386292b7eef52b97380e268c509f225c73c3627bb4578ef14cc88fafc30:0
- value
- 2098045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2b44e5efd07da0c63ca7faeac264807eebbb6af OP_EQUAL
- address
- 3KSX1eb5Cap9km71ytjp4UYhpP4iVjUDVG